Getting Around:
This home's convenient location not only allows for walking to Main Street and Old Town, but places it within steps of the Old Town Transit Center, where several Park City Transit Bus routes meet. Park City Transit is free and the buses run at regular intervals. The routes from this transit hub connect you with Park City Mountain, Canyons and Deer Valley Resorts.

Time to get to Deer Valley Resort’s lower base area called Snow Park Lodge is a short 5-minute bus ride that drops you a short 100-yard walk to the ski lifts. If you want to start your day at Deer Valley’s Empire Lodge, take the number 9 bus from the transit center, just on the other side of the Marsac roundabout. For those who want to ski Park City Mountain Resort, it's a short 10-minute bus ride. And for the Canyons base area, take the #10 express bus and jump on the cabriolet lift to start your day. All these are free and help minimize traffic in Park City, plus they save you a lot of money and hassle.
